Meeting notes — returned demo units (Vantor ScanPad line)

Attendees agreed that all fourteen demo units returned from the Halbrook trade fair require inspection before restocking. Six show screen wear and go to refurbishment; the remainder re-enter demo rotation. Serials must be reconciled against the fair loan sheet, and any missing styluses noted on the discrepancy log. Pelray Couriers will move the refurb units Wednesday. The confidential instruction for that hand-over is recorded directly below.

handover note for yagef-bagep: the drudor pelius courier leaves the kasdor zorvan norir ledger at gate 8016 under passcode 755406

The Ledgerlens audit-log viewer exposes a read-only REST interface for retrieving audit events by actor, resource, or time range. Pagination uses opaque cursors; results are immutable once written. All requests route through the internal Gatewick proxy and must include the service key provided below.

app token of bawep-hafog = kto7_vwrmnlx

// Elevator-dispatch simulator: core constants for the Torvane building model.
// Read this before touching anything. Dispatch scoring weighs wait time,
// car load, and travel distance; the weights below were fit against the
// Hollis Tower trace data and are fragile. Do not retune without rerunning
// the full regression suite in sim/bench. Floor dwell and door timings
// assume the standard cab profile. The tuning constants follow.

constants for hahip-hafog:
WEIGHTS = {
    "feniel": 55,
    "kasox": 667,
}